How Shapewear Works and What It Targets
Shapewear works by using firm, structured fabrics and graduated compression to smooth, lift, or redirect tissue. Materials such as nylon, spandex, and power mesh create consistent, flexible pressure on specific zones while allowing some breathability. Common targeted areas include the abdomen, hips, thighs, and under the bust. Compression garments can minimize the visibility of certain contours, but they cannot eliminate fat or permanently alter body composition. Understanding these limits helps users set realistic goals and avoid unsafe practices such as choosing sizes that are too small.
Core Construction Methods
Manufacturers use seamed, bonded, or laser-cut edges to reduce chafing and visible lines under fitted clothing. Seamed designs often allow for more structured shaping, while bonded or laser-cut garments prioritize a smooth finish. Reinforced panels and strategic stitching provide durability in high-friction areas. Some styles incorporate boning or flexible plastic stays to maintain the desired silhouette. The combination of these construction details influences comfort, longevity, and the smoothness of the final look under different outfits.

Fit, Sizing, and Measurement Practices
Proper fit is essential for both effectiveness and comfort. Measure your natural waist, hips, and thighs with a soft tape while standing comfortably, and compare these numbers to the brand’s size chart rather than your usual clothing size. Many manufacturers list detailed measurement ranges for each size, which reduces guesswork. Consider that compression levels can differ between brands: what feels firm in one label may be moderate in another. Trying on multiple sizes when possible, or checking return policies, helps ensure the garment stays in place without cutting off circulation.
Fit Checklist for Safer Use
- You can comfortably breathe and move without the fabric digging in.
- No numbness, tingling, or color changes in the skin.
- Seams and edges align smoothly with your body contours.
- The waistband sits level and does not roll down during activity.

Material Choices, Breathability, and Skin Care
The blend of fibers affects comfort, durability, and how the garment feels on sensitive skin. Nylon and spandex offer stretch and recovery, while cotton-rich blends can be softer and more breathable for all-day use. Power mesh delivers firm support with some stretch, but may feel less comfortable for continuous wear. If you have sensitive skin, look for seamless options, tagless designs, and gentle detergents. Removing shapewear at the end of the day and allowing skin to air out can reduce irritation and support overall skin health.
When to Avoid or Limit Shapewear Use
Certain medical conditions and situations call for caution or avoidance. People with circulation issues, skin infections, severe sensitive skin, or respiratory conditions should consult a healthcare provider before using firm compression garments. After surgery or injury, follow your clinician’s guidance rather than relying on non-medical shapewear. If you experience pain, persistent numbness, or skin irritation while wearing shapewear, stop use and seek advice. Choosing looser options or focusing on fit and comfort can help reduce these risks.

Care and Longevity Tips
Gentle care practices help shapewear last longer and perform consistently. Hand washing or using a mesh bag on a delicate cycle with mild detergent protects fibers and elastics. Avoid hot water, bleach, and harsh agitation, which can degrade material strength. Lay garments flat to dry away from direct heat, and limit frequent high-heat drying. Rotate between multiple pieces to reduce daily wear on any single item, and inspect seams and waistbands regularly for signs of wear.
